85 Points
(view details)

muhammad
About muhammad
Currently in Seoul
Home base in Muscat
Joined in July, 2024
80s Kid
Interests
Technology
Music
Backpacking
Movies
National Parks

Log in or Join GAFFL to view muhammad's full profile.